Output 34ae6ce78d6686014997fd06b62421c3e3dd8546bcbe7972a8a482fe1171b1c0:7

value
30387354
script pubkey
OP_0 OP_PUSHBYTES_20 71d73e223ec60010ba1941c4a16df12d6c518afb
address
ltc1qw8tnug37ccqppwseg8z2zm0394k9rzhm85xru3
transaction
34ae6ce78d6686014997fd06b62421c3e3dd8546bcbe7972a8a482fe1171b1c0
spent
true